Volumes I and II only. [4] xxiv, 458pp, plus 15 plate illustrations at rear; [6], 472pp, plus 32 plate illustrations at rear. In blue cloth-covered boards. 8vo. Volume one - cloth shelf worn, rubbed and rounded at corners and spine ends, backstrip absent, boards detached, front free endpaper absent, half title loose. A little faint and occasional spotting on plates especially, small stamp of the Wellcome Library on reverse of title page, some minor damage to edges of pages, else internally neat and clean. Volume two - cloth worn, rubbed and rounded on edges, corners, spine joints and tips, some loss at spine head, spine label soiled and chipped. Volume a little loose. Internally some faint and occasional spotting, especially to plates, and small stamp from Wellcome Library on reverse of title page. Very hard to find set.
